Interior Ministry notifies metropolitan government

Published on: June 15, 2016 1:17 AM

ISLAMABAD: The interior ministry has issued a notification about the metropolitan government in Islamabad besides giving indication for issuance of a separate notification about functions to be transferred to the ICT Metropolitan Corporation and the Capital Development Authority (CDA) within a few days.

The ICT Metropolitan Corporation will start functioning soon after issuance of the notification about distribution of departments.

According to information received by Daily Times 23 directorates will be transferred to the Metropolitan government. They include Directorate of Health Services, Cares 112, Directorate of Municipal Administration, Sports and Culture, Capital Hospital, CDA Model School, Coordination, Public Relations, Security and IT Management (Administration), MQC and CE lab, G and H lab, Bulk water management, Water and Sewerage (Dev), M and RM directorate, Water supply directorate, sewerage treatment plant, Machinery pool organization (Engineering), Environment (East), Environment (Urban/West), Sanitation, E and DM (Environment) and Head of Treasury (Finance).

The functions to be retained by the CDA include Director staff, secretary CDA Board, Training academy, planning and design, Urban planning, Building control, Regional planning, Housing Societies (Administration), Works, Quantity Survey, Programme and Evaluation, Special projects,, sector development (Civil), sector development ( E and M), project sector I-15, Special project, (Bari Imam), coordination (Parliament House), E and M (Dev), Aiwan-e-Sadr, Parliament lodges and hostel (Engineering), zoo and wildlife management (West), Estate Management (Commercial), Land and Rehabilitation,, Sr Special magistrate (Environment) and procurement and contracts (Finance).
